Rapunzel



I call her Rapunzel, though her hair is short and neat,
For her beauty is much more than her hair, a treat.
She has a smile that can light up a darkened room,
And a heart that's pure and full of love, like a blooming bloom.

Her hair may not be long, but her spirit is strong,
And her love  never falters, never goes wrong.
She's my rock, my support, and my guiding light,
She helps me through my struggles, and holds me tight.

She may not be a princess in a tower so high,
But she's the queen of my heart, and that's no lie.
I call her Rapunzel, for she's my fairytale dream,
And with her by my side, life is a beautiful, wonderful theme.
